Saudi Arabian GP: Fernando Alonso reinstated to third after Aston Martin appeal penalty

Summary by Ground News
Fernando Alonso has been restored to third place in the 2023 Saudi Arabian Grand Prix after a time penalty was overturned. Alonso, 41, finished third in the second race of the season, behind race-winner Sergio Perez and championship leader Max Verstappen, both Red Bull. Alonso was penalised for being lined up incorrectly and slightly out of place.
